Andrew Tate Suffers defeat in Boxing Debut Against Chase DeMoor
Table of Contents
A majority decision loss to Chase DeMoor in Dubai marked a disappointing return to combat sports for controversial influencer Andrew Tate on Saturday night. The fight, a highly anticipated event within the Misfits Boxing series, saw Tate fall short against the reigning heavyweight champion after a six-round contest.
Tate’s Return to the Ring After Five years
The bout represented Tate’s first foray into combat sports in five years, drawing important attention due to his global profile. Despite a promising start, utilizing his speed and landing effective strikes, Tate ultimately succumbed to DeMoor’s physicality and endurance.
A Grueling six rounds: How the Fight Unfolded
The fight began with Tate demonstrating early success, effectively employing jabs and body shots that appeared to trouble DeMoor in the opening rounds.By the second round, it seemed the American champion was struggling to cope with Tate’s initial offensive pressure.However, the momentum shifted dramatically in the third round.
DeMoor began to leverage his size advantage, relying heavily on clinching to wear down Tate.This tactic, while effective, drew criticism from the crowd. The middle rounds saw a noticeable decline in Tate’s energy levels as DeMoor’s strength began to dominate.
The fifth and sixth rounds proved particularly challenging for Tate, as DeMoor landed a series of powerful uppercuts that visibly impacted the influencer. Despite enduring significant pressure and several near knockdowns, Tate managed to survive until the final bell.
Official Scorecards and Expert Reaction
The judges’ scorecards reflected the closely contested nature of the fight, reading 57-57, 58-56, and 58-56 in favor of DeMoor. Former UFC middleweight champion michael Bisping offered a scathing assessment of the performance, stating, “God, they both suck… this is hilariously bad.”
Tate Acknowledges Age and Hiatus as Factors
Following the match,a visibly dejected Tate acknowledged that his extended absence from the sport and his age likely contributed to the outcome.He extended praise to DeMoor’s toughness, stating, “It’s better to try and lose then to not try at all.”
Future Boxing Plans Remain Uncertain
While acknowledging his defeat, Tate did not definitively rule out a return to boxing. He indicated he would review the fight footage before making a final decision regarding his future participation in the sport.
Undercard Highlights
The event also featured several other notable bouts. Former UFC star Tony Ferguson secured the Misfits middleweight title with a unanimous decision victory over Warren Spencer. Additional results included Amado Vargas defeating Deen the Great and Neeraj Goyat overcoming Anthony Taylor.
